Проектирование реляционной базы данных автоматизации учета методом нормализации

Заказать уникальную курсовую работу
Тип работы: Курсовая работа
Предмет: Проектирование баз данных
  • 29 29 страниц
  • 8 + 8 источников
  • Добавлена 20.02.2022
1 496 руб.
  • Содержание
  • Часть работы
  • Список литературы
  • Вопросы/Ответы
Содержание

Определения, обозначения и сокращения 4
Введение 5
1. Теоретическая часть 6
1.1. Описание предметной области. Постановка задачи 6
1.2. Описание входных данных 6
1.3. Описание выходных данных 7
1.4. Перечень ограничений на базу данных 8
1.5. Построение инфологической модели 8
1.6. Выбор и обоснование инструментальных средств 9
1.7. Даталогическое моделирование 10
1.8. Выводы по теоретической части 11
2. Практическая часть 13
2.1. Физическая модель данных 13
2.2. Установление связей между таблицами 15
2.3. Запросы к базе данных 17
2.4. Пользовательские формы 19
2.5. Отчеты базы данных 21
2.6. Кнопочная форма 22
2.7. Руководство пользователя 25
2.8. Выводы по практической части 26
Заключение 28
Список использованных источников 29

Фрагмент для ознакомления

Модель, Приборы.Состояние, Sum(Приборы.Стоимость) AS [Sum-Стоимость]FROM МоделиПриборов INNER JOIN Приборы ON МоделиПриборов.Код = Приборы.МодельGROUP BY МоделиПриборов.Модель, Приборы.СостояниеHAVING (((Приборы.Состояние)=3))Результат:Запрос5МодельСостояниеSum-СтоимостьАкустический уровнемерНеисправен18 000.00 ₽Поплавковый уровнемерНеисправен190 000.00 ₽2.4. Пользовательские формыДалее было проведено проектирование пользовательских форм, используемых для ввода информации в таблицы БД. Форма справочника моделей приборов приведена на рис.9.Рисунок – Форма справочника моделей приборовНа рис.10 приведена форма справочника отделов.Рисунок 10 – Форма справочника подразделенийНа рис.11 приведена форма справочника сотрудников.Рисунок 11 – Форма справочника сотрудниковНа рис.12 приведён справочник приборов.Рисунок 12 – Форма справочника приборов2.5. Отчеты базы данныхНа рис.13 приведен отчет по выданным приборамРисунок 13 – Отчёт по списку выданных приборовНа рис.14 приведён отчет по количеству имеющихся приборов по моделям.Рисунок 14 – Отчёт по количеству приборов по моделямНа рис.15 приведён отчет по стоимости неисправных приборов.Рисунок 15 – Отчёт по стоимости неисправных приборов2.6. Кнопочная формаДля обеспечения быстрого доступа к режимам работы с базой данных проведено создание кнопочной формы. Для этого проводится создание пустой формы, на которой проводится настройка действий по нажатию кнопок (рис.16-18).Рисунок – Выбор действияРисунок 17 – Выбор формыРисунок 18 – Ввод названия кнопкиНа рис.19 приведен вид главной кнопочной формы.Рисунок 19 – Вид главной кнопочной формыДля возможности автоматического запуска главной формы проведена настройка запуска базы данных (рис.20).Рисунок 20 – Настройка запуска главной кнопочной формы2.7. Руководство пользователяСистемные требования:ОЗУ от 4 GB;Частота процессора – от 3 ГГц;ОС Windows 7 и выше;Наличие установленного MS Access.Для доступа к работе с системой необходимо запустить файл базы данных, после чего открывается доступ к работе с основными режимами работы с системой (рис.21). Доступ к данным осуществляется путем перехода к соответствующим режимам работы из кнопочной формы, либо непосредственно из меню объектов системы.Система обеспечивает возможности работы со справочной информацией о приборах КИП и А, их моделях, сотрудниках предприятия, отделах. Обеспечиваются возможности формирования отчётной информации, с которой работают специалисты склада КИП и А.Рисунок – Режим работы с системой2.8. Выводы по практической частиВ практической части работы проведено создание базы данных в соответствии с построенной в теоретическом разделе моделью. Проведена разработка наиболее востребованных запросов, разработаны формы для возможности работы пользователей с объектами базы данных, разработаны печатные формы отчетов.ЗаключениеВ данной работе разработана проекта автоматизации технологии складского учета в части учета выдачи приборов КИП и А. В ходе работы была изучена специфика технологии документооборота в рамках учета хранения продукции на складе, поступления и выдачи продукции. Автоматизация технологии учета приборов КИП и Ана складе предполагает возможности оперативного получения информации о местонахождении имущества, его стоимости, ответственных специалистах. Повышение качества работы с информацией учета приборов КИП и Апозволит сократить вероятность краж и потерь имущества, используемого в работе сотрудников и производственной деятельности компании.В рамках исследования бизнес-процессов проведена постановка задач автоматизации документооборота учета приборов КИП и А, определен перечень недостатков существующей технологии обработки информации.В проектной части работы определен перечень задач автоматизации складского учета, определен перечень информационных объектов, установлены связи между ними, проведено построение концептуальной модели. Далее проведено построение логической и физической моделей данных, разработан прототип информационной системы складского учета с использованием системы MSAccess.Список использованных источниковНадейкина Л. А. Программирование. Обобщенное программирование: учебное пособие. - Москва: Московский государственный технический университет ГА, 2019. - 80 с.Помазанов В. В., Лунина Е. С. Проектирование баз данных: учебное пособие / В. В. Помазанов, Е. С. Лунина. - Краснодар: КубГАУ, 2017. - 178 с.Стрекалова Н. Б., Маризина В. Н. Современные технологии в профессиональной подготовке специалистов: учебное пособие. - Тольятти: Тольяттинская академия управления, 2016. - 128 с.Сурушкин М. А. Анализ предметной области и проектирование информационных систем с примерами : учебное пособие. - Белгород: НИУ "БелГУ", 2019. - 155 с.Терехова А. Е. Моделирование бизнес-процессов: учебное пособие. - Москва: Изд. дом ФГБОУВО "ГУУ", 2016. - 96 с.Шичкина Ю. А. Методы построения схемы и выполнения запросов в базах данных. - Санкт-Петербург : Изд-во СПбГЭТУ "ЛЭТИ", 2016. - 205 с.Шмелева С. В. Информационные технологии: конспект лекций / С. В. Шмелева. - Москва: Российский университет дружбы народов, 2018. - 72 с.Щеглов, Ю.А. Информационные системы и процессы. - Новосибирск: НИНХ, 2015. - 251 с.

Список использованных источников

1. Надейкина Л. А. Программирование. Обобщенное программирование: учебное пособие. - Москва: Московский государственный технический университет ГА, 2019. - 80 с.
2. Помазанов В. В., Лунина Е. С. Проектирование баз данных: учебное пособие / В. В. Помазанов, Е. С. Лунина. - Краснодар: КубГАУ, 2017. - 178 с.
3. Стрекалова Н. Б., Маризина В. Н. Современные технологии в профессиональной подготовке специалистов: учебное пособие. - Тольятти: Тольяттинская академия управления, 2016. - 128 с.
4. Сурушкин М. А. Анализ предметной области и проектирование информационных систем с примерами : учебное пособие. - Белгород: НИУ "БелГУ", 2019. - 155 с.
5. Терехова А. Е. Моделирование бизнес-процессов: учебное пособие. - Москва: Изд. дом ФГБОУВО "ГУУ", 2016. - 96 с.
6. Шичкина Ю. А. Методы построения схемы и выполнения запросов в базах данных. - Санкт-Петербург : Изд-во СПбГЭТУ "ЛЭТИ", 2016. - 205 с.
7. Шмелева С. В. Информационные технологии: конспект лекций / С. В. Шмелева. - Москва: Российский университет дружбы народов, 2018. - 72 с.
8. Щеглов, Ю.А. Информационные системы и процессы. - Новосибирск: НИНХ, 2015. - 251 с.

Вопрос-ответ:

Какие инструментальные средства были выбраны для проектирования базы данных автоматизации учета?

Для проектирования базы данных автоматизации учета были выбраны следующие инструментальные средства: ... (указать выбранные инструменты) Этот выбор обосновывается следующими причинами: ... (указать причины выбора)

Какие ограничения на базу данных были учтены при ее проектировании для автоматизации учета?

При проектировании базы данных для автоматизации учета были учтены следующие ограничения: ... (указать ограничения) Это было сделано для обеспечения правильной работы системы учета и предотвращения возможных ошибок.

Какую модель данных была выбрана при построении инфологической модели базы данных для автоматизации учета?

При построении инфологической модели базы данных для автоматизации учета была выбрана реляционная модель данных. Это было сделано для обеспечения эффективного хранения и обработки данных, а также для обеспечения целостности и надежности системы учета.

Какие задачи были поставлены при проектировании базы данных для автоматизации учета?

При проектировании базы данных для автоматизации учета были поставлены следующие задачи: ... (указать задачи) Целью проекта было создание эффективной системы учета, способной автоматизировать рутинные процессы и обеспечить удобный доступ к данным.

Какие данные являются входными для базы данных автоматизации учета?

Входными данными для базы данных автоматизации учета являются следующие данные: ... (указать входные данные) Эти данные могут быть получены из различных источников, таких как документы, электронные формы и т.д.

Какое преимущество имеет проектирование реляционной базы данных?

Преимущества проектирования реляционной базы данных включают: логическую структуру данных, простоту в использовании и понимании, возможность эффективного управления данными, гибкость в изменении структуры базы данных и возможность обеспечения целостности данных.

Какие задачи ставятся перед проектированием реляционной базы данных?

Задачи проектирования реляционной базы данных включают: определение предметной области, постановка задачи, описание входных и выходных данных, определение ограничений на базу данных, построение инфологической и даталогической моделей.

Какие инструментальные средства используются при проектировании реляционной базы данных?

При проектировании реляционной базы данных могут быть использованы различные инструментальные средства, такие как CASE-средства, базы данных, языки программирования и т.д. Выбор конкретных инструментальных средств зависит от требований проекта и возможностей разработчика.

Что представляет собой даталогическое моделирование при проектировании реляционной базы данных?

Даталогическое моделирование при проектировании реляционной базы данных представляет собой процесс создания даталогической модели, которая описывает структуру базы данных, включая сущности, атрибуты и связи между ними. Даталогическая модель служит основой для создания физической структуры базы данных.